Its been a while since I've been in your shoes so I am coming to you for opinions.  I have a very good friend who has struggled with infertility for two years who just found out that she was KU!  (Yay!)  She has an early u/s this afternoon, she is most likely around 6 weeks, and asked me today to help her come up with questions.  She is very nervous because she has had a previous loss and wants to get everything answered possible.  All I remember is knowing that the actual measurement really mattered this early just because with DS the docs told me I was miscarrying based on his size...they were wrong obviously!  Anyway...  

What did you ask at your first appt / u/s?  TIA

Just remind her it may be too early to hear a heartbeat.
Weve had some ladies on here recently that have had added stress because of this. One lady was told to terminate meanwhile there was a heartbeat the following week!!

Id ask any questions she has about her diet, prenatals, what meds are safe if she needs some, what she can expect in general.
I wanted to know what lotions to use for my dry legs!
Any concerns arent too small. So she should ask away!

To be quite honest with you unless there is a specific question in mind, most every thing you could ask could be found in a good book or online. I would tell her to invest in a good book. Not to say there is nothing you can ask, but in a normal healthy pregnancy questions like diet, things like that are in books. Also with my first the nurse came in and went over everything so I didn't even have to ask. If she has a concern ask about it, or if she wants to get a feel of the practice then ask about how they run their office.I don't think she needs to brainstorm for questions though. Congrats to her!
